How do you teach a preschooler to plants?
Set a plant in a corner of the daycare, where children are sure to notice it. Begin a conversation about plants. Name the different parts of a plant. Ask children if they know how to take care of a plant so it will grow and be healthy.

What are language skills for preschoolers?
Language development: 4-5 years. At 4-5 years, children are getting better at conversations. They can use longer sentences and take turns speaking. Preschoolers can say what they're thinking, tell stories and describe feelings.
What are the 3 life cycles of a plant?
There are three different plant life cycles: haploid (1n), diploid (2n), and the more common haploid-diploid (1n-2n). A haploid organism consists of a multicellular structure of cells that contain only one set of chromosomes, whereas, a diploid organism's multicellular stage contains two sets of chromosomes.
What plants need to grow activity?
Plants, like all living things, have basic needs that must be met for them to survive. These needs include: light, air, water, a source of nutrition, space to live and grow and optimal temperature. Why is art and craft important for preschoolers?
Arts and craft activities help instil a sense of achievement and pride in children, boosting theirself-confidence. The opportunity to create whatever a child desires helps foster creativity. A child will learn to make correct and effective decisions by facing and solving artistic challenges.

What is an example of creative play?
For example: Give your child an empty cardboard box to make a house, a robot, a truck, an animal – whatever your child is interested in. Your child could paint the box or decorate it with craft materials. Use empty kitchen or toilet rolls or small plastic juice bottles to make people.

What is a creative play?
Creative play involves self-expression and the mastery of physical, social and cognitive skills. It is all about training the brain and body to function in the real world. Play helps to develop language and communication skills which enable children to learn academically as they go through the education system.
